Binky Felstead praised by charity for helping to break the taboo surrounding miscarriage
Made in Chelsea star explained she had “thought long and hard” about whether or not to speak publicly about the loss.“But I felt that if I can pass on any warmth, comfort or help to anybody in the same position - well that would be great,” she wrote in an Instagram caption alongside a scenic image of a field at sunset, posted on Monday 12 October.Ruth Bender Atik, national director of the Miscarriage Association told Yahoo UK that the charity “greatly appreciates” Binky’s decision to share her
